How to Make Cheesy Texas Toast
Ingredients:
- 6 slices of thick-cut Texas toast bread
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1/2 teaspoon dried parsley
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ley (optional, for garnish)
Directions:
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or aluminum foil for easy cleanup.
- In a small bowl, mix together the softened butter, minced garlic, garlic powder, dried oregano, and dried parsley until well combined.
- Spread a generous amount of the garlic butter mixture on one side of each slice of bread, making sure to coat the edges as well.
- Place the buttered slices on the prepared baking sheet, buttered side up.
- Sprinkle an even layer of mozzarella, cheddar, and Parmesan cheese over each slice.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ly, and the edges of the bread are golden brown.
- Remove from the oven and let cool slightly. Garnish with chopped fresh parsley if desired.
- Serve warm. For extra crispiness, you can broil for the last 1-2 minutes, watching closely to avoid burning.
How to Serve Cheesy Texas Toast
Cheesy Texas Toast is best served warm right out of the oven. You can enjoy it as is or pair it with your favorite soups or salads. It also makes a fantastic side for pasta dishes or grilled meats. For a fun twist, serve it alongside marinara sauce for dipping!
How to Store Cheesy Texas Toast
If you have any le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They will keep well for about 2-3 days. To reheat, place the toast in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 5-7 minutes or until warmed through. You can also pop them in the toaster oven for a quick reheating option.
Tips to Make Cheesy Texas Toast
- Feel free to adjust the amount of garlic in the butter mixture to suit your taste.
- If you want to add some heat, try sprinkling some red pepper flakes on top of the cheese before baking.
- You can use different types of cheese or even add toppings like cooked bacon or herbs for extra flavor!
Variation
For a twist on the classic recipe, try adding chopped fresh tomatoes or diced jalapeños on top of the cheese before baking. This will give your Cheesy Texas Toast a unique flavor and flair.
FAQs
Can I use regular bread instead of Texas toast?
Yes, you can use any type of bread you like, but Texas toast is thicker and can hold more cheese and butter for a heartier bite.
How do I make this recipe dairy-free?
You can substitute non-dairy butter and cheese alternatives to make a dairy-free version of Cheesy Texas Toast.
Can I make the garlic butter 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the garlic butter mixture in advance and store it in the refrigerator for up to a week. Just spread it on the bread and bake when you’re ready to enjoy!
